Output d09e63f2a28932e2097a128472dcd62b2fcf1fa2fc4512e2cb9eb8d43410239f:0

value
28832000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b61182574d1e8fa2e220af531414a17beec1fd OP_EQUAL
address
3AbfaV6NMGhVUmGNXUnAfJucLBmJyo3Cx8
transaction
d09e63f2a28932e2097a128472dcd62b2fcf1fa2fc4512e2cb9eb8d43410239f
confirmations
117332
spent
true